Elden Ring Sales Reach 30 Million and Still Climbing

In the ever-evolving world of video games, few titles have captured the imagination and dedication of players quite like Elden Ring. Developed by the renowned FromSoftware, this action role-playing game has recently achieved a remarkable milestone, surpassing 30 million sales worldwide. Known for its challenging gameplay and intricate world-building, Elden Ring not only sets a new standard for the genre but also proves that its appeal continues to resonate deeply with both new and veteran gamers alike. The Impact of Expansion Packs

Elden Ring’s remarkable success isn’t just due to the base game; expansion packs play a crucial role, too. The recent release of the Shadow of the Erdtree expansion sold over five million copies in just three days! Such incredible sales figures indicate that fans are eager for more content and experiences within the game’s universe. Expansions keep the excitement alive, offering fresh challenges and narratives for both new and returning players.

Cross-Promotion Boosts Sales

Elden Ring’s success has positively impacted FromSoftware’s other franchises, particularly the Dark Souls series. Since the launch of Elden Ring, sales of the Dark Souls trilogy surged from 27 million to 35 million units sold. The interest generated by Elden Ring has introduced many new players to the dark and challenging realms of Dark Souls, demonstrating how a successful title can create a domino effect in a developer’s catalog.

This cross-promotion shows the power of a successful franchise in boosting related titles. New players, eager to explore more challenging experiences, often seek out the games that inspired Elden Ring. As they dive into the Dark Souls universe, they develop a deeper appreciation for FromSoftware’s games, which can result in continued sales for years to come.

Looking Ahead: Future Developments

Elden Ring’s journey is far from over, with exciting developments on the horizon. Although a direct sequel isn’t in the works yet, the upcoming spin-off, Elden Ring: Nightreign, is set to expand the universe further. Scheduled for release on May 30, 2025, this battle royale-inspired adventure is expected to attract new players while engaging the existing fanbase. Such spin-offs are pivotal for breathing new life into game worlds.

In addition to this spin-off, Elden Ring will make its debut on the Nintendo Switch 2. This release opens up the game to an entirely new audience, allowing fans to enjoy the game on a portable console for the first time. With each new development, Elden Ring continues to attract players, ensuring that its impressive sales numbers will only keep growing.
